Things to Know About Filter Sizes

Finger pointing to nominal size

Nominal Size

  • The rounded size printed on your filter or HVAC unit (e.g., 16.5x21x1).
  • Usually whole numbers to make identifying and ordering easier.
  • A label for compatibility—not the exact measurement.
Finger pointing to actual size

Actual Size

  • The true, trimmed dimensions of the filter (e.g., 16.50x21.00x0.75" inches).
  • Filters are manufactured slightly smaller so they slide into the filter slot without forcing.
  • If you don't know your nominal size, measure your filter to get the actual size, then round up to find the nominal size to search on our site.
Help icon

Why the difference?

  • Nominal sizes simplify shopping and standardize categories.
  • Actual sizes ensure the filter fits properly inside your HVAC's filter rack.

How To Find Your Nominal Size When You Don't Know It

Air Filter Explaining Each Size
Nom 16.5"Act 16.50"
Nom 1"Act 0.75"
Nom 21"Act 21.00"
1

Measure length × width × depth with a tape measure to find the actual size.

2

Round up each dimension to the nearest whole number to get the nominal size. Example: 16.50x21.00x0.75" in → 16.5x21x1 nominal.

3

Search by nominal size on our site for the best fit.

Help icon
Pro tips: If your filter is missing or damaged, measure the filter slot opening the same way.

Why Getting the Right Size Matters

  • Too small? Air can bypass the filter, reducing air quality and efficiency.
  • Too big? It won't fit—risking bent frames and airflow issues.
  • Just right? You get maximum performance, better filtration, and cleaner air.

How Often Should You Change Your Filter?

Changing your filter on time keeps your HVAC system running efficiently—and helps protect your lungs from dust, allergens, and airborne irritants. Here's how often to swap it out based on your needs:

Calendar Illustration Every 90 days

Every 90 Days

Standard Schedule

For most homes without pets or special air quality concerns. Great for general upkeep and energy efficiency.

Calendar Illustration Every 60 days

Every 60 Days

If You Have Pets or Allergies

Shedding fur, dander, and allergy triggers can build up fast. Changing your filter every two months helps keep the air fresher and symptoms at bay.

Calendar Illustration Every 30 days

Every 30 Days

If You Have Respiratory Concerns or Live in Smog/Wildfire Zones

For households affected by smoke, pollution, or respiratory conditions, monthly changes ensure maximum protection.

Supporting Statistics, Backed by Experience

At FilterBuy, our testing and customer feedback align with what research confirms:

  1. Indoor air is often more polluted than outdoor air. Americans spend about 90% of their time indoors, where pollutant levels can be 2–5 times higher than outdoors (EPA).

  2. Filtration is essential—not optional. The EPA recognizes high-quality filters as one of the most effective supplements to ventilation—because simply opening windows isn’t enough (EPA on Filtration).

  3. MERV ratings require balance. According to ASHRAE, higher MERV means more particle capture but also more airflow resistance. Our experience shows MERV 8 is the sweet spot—strong enough to trap dust, pollen, and dander, while protecting HVAC efficiency (ASHRAE).

Frequently Asked Questions

Is MERV 8 a good AC filter?

Yes. MERV 8 filters are the smart choice for most homes. They capture common irritants like dust, pollen, lint, and pet dander—while still allowing your HVAC system to run efficiently.

What’s the best MERV rating for AC filters?

For most residential systems, MERV 8–11 is ideal. This range balances cleaner air with proper airflow so your equipment doesn’t get overworked.

How long does a MERV 8 filter last?

Typically up to 90 days. If you have pets, allergies, or heavy dust, replace every 30–60 days for best results.

Does a lower MERV rating increase airflow?

Yes—but with tradeoffs. Lower MERV filters restrict airflow less, but also capture fewer pollutants.

Is MERV 11 too high for residential use?

Not usually. Most modern systems can handle MERV 11. Older units may struggle, so always check your manufacturer’s recommendations.

Does MERV 8 remove dust?

Absolutely. MERV 8 filters are specifically designed to trap dust, lint, and debris, keeping your air cleaner and your system protected.

What happens if you don’t change your furnace filter?

Airflow drops, energy bills rise, and dust builds up inside your system. Over time, this can cause breakdowns and shorten your HVAC’s lifespan.

What is the CFM rating of a MERV 8 filter?

It varies by filter size and brand, but generally MERV 8 filters allow strong airflow—typically requiring around 300–400 CFM per ton of cooling capacity in residential systems.
